Replacing the Sanding Sheet
When attaching a new sanding sheet, remove any
dust or debris from the sanding plate 6 (e. g. with
a brush).
To ensure optimum dust extraction, pay atten-
tion that the punched holes in the sanding sheet
match with the holes in the sanding plate.
Sanding Sheets with Velcro Backing
(see figure A)
The sanding plate 6 is fitted with Velcro backing
for quick and easy fastening of sanding sheets
with Velcro adhesion.
Before attaching the sanding sheet 7, free the
Velcro backing of the sanding plate 6 from any
debris by tapping against it in order to enable op-
timum adhesion.
Position the sanding sheet 7 flush alongside one
edge of the sanding plate 6, then lay the sanding
sheet onto the sanding plate and press it against
it with a light turning motion in clockwise direc-
tion.
To remove the sanding sheet 7, grasp it at one of
the tips and pull it off from the sanding plate 6.
Sanding Sheets without Velcro Backing
(see figures BD)
n Press the release button 8 and keep it de-
pressed.
o Guide the sanding sheet 7 to the stop under
the opened front clamping bracket 9 and let
go of the release button 8 again. Pay atten-
tion that the sanding sheet is clamped cen-
trally.
p Press the sanding sheet clamp 5 inward and
pivot it to the stop.
q Fold the sanding sheet 7 firmly around the
sanding plate. Guide the other end of the
sanding sheet 7 between the rear clamping
bracket and the red roller on the clamping
bracket 5.
r Hold the sanding sheet tensely and press the
clamping bracket 5 toward the sanding plate
to lock the sanding sheet.
Sanding sheets without holes, e. g. from rolls or
by the meter, can be punctured with the perfo-
rating tool 10 for use with dust extraction. For
this, press the machine with the mounted sand-
ing sheet onto the perforating tool (see figure E).
To remove the sanding sheet 7, loosen the
clamping bracket 5 and pull out the sanding
sheet from the rear holding fixture. Press the re-
lease button 8 and completely remove the sand-
ing sheet.
Selecting the Sanding Sheet
Depending on the material to be worked and the
required rate of material removal, different sand-
ing sheets are available:
Grain size
For the working of
all wooden materials
40240
For coarse-sanding,
e. g. of rough, un-
planed beams and
boards coarse 40, 60
For face sanding and
planing small irregu-
larities medium 80, 100, 120
For finish and fine
sanding of hard
woods fine 180, 240
For the working of
paint/enamel coats
or primers and fillers
40
320
For sanding off paint coarse 40, 60
For sanding primer medium 80, 100, 120
For final sanding of
primers before coat-
ing fine 180, 240, 320
